The Pacific Highway reopened overnight following bushfires across NSW over the weekend.
However, The Lakes Way near Rainbow Flat between Failford Road and the Pacific Highway remains closed.
Motorists have been advised to continue to delay all non-essential travel in bushfire-affected areas as a number of other roads also remain closed.
Failford Road is open to local traffic only from Forster-Tuncurry to Nabiac
Motorists who need to travel in bushfire-affected areas should be prepared for conditions to change quickly, and follow the directions of emergency services and traffic crews.
